MEMO — Warehouse Shift Lead

The crate of Veldtline survey instruments from the Harrowmere field team arrives Tuesday on the early run. Do not open it; the theodolites inside are calibrated and sealed by Quennel Surveys. Store it in the climate bay, not general racking. A courier from Marlow Transit collects it Wednesday before noon. Log the weight on intake and flag any seal damage to me directly. The hand-over instruction for the courier follows below.

handover note for yagef-bagep: the drudor pelius courier leaves the kasdor zorvan norir ledger at gate 8016 under passcode 755406

Branch managers: figures below are provisional until sign-off by Director Halvane.

- Net growth capped at 6% company-wide.
- Priority hires: Strood and Kelverton branches (logistics, two roles each).
- Pemford branch: freeze continues through H1.
- Backfills require regional approval; no exceptions.
- Contractor conversions count against branch quota.
- Submit draft org charts by end of month via the planning tracker.

Do not share figures outside the management group. The rationale driving these caps is recorded below.

confidential, kagep-kahof: Druokax Systems plans to lower the Ulaath list price by 53 percent in March.

## Service Accounts — Points Ledger

The Lumera loyalty-points ledger runs under the `ledger-writer` service account, which is the only identity allowed to post debit/credit entries. Read-only dashboards use a separate account, so blast radius stays small. For your review, note that all writes are audited nightly. The ledger API authenticates with the key shown below.

service key, tadup-tahog: zpat7_wB1tnEL

Subject: Timetable solver cut-over complete

Team — the cut-over from the legacy Bellchime scheduler to the new Rostrum solver finished last night for all Hollowmere district schools. Solve times dropped from roughly twenty minutes to under three, and the constraint conflicts that plagued term-start week are resolved at submission time now. Old Bellchime endpoints return a redirect until month end. If a school reports odd results, check the solver tier first. Production runs with the configuration below.

deployment values, yahag-tawef:
ZORWYN_HOST=zorwyn.tolvaqlabs.internal
ZORWYN_PORT=9300